The only way i found in kdenlive is to add a transition between the picture and another picture in png where i got only shadow. 

So, i need 8 tracks to "shadow" 4 pics

Is it correct that you need the drop shadow only for picture in picture clips? Then this should be easily doable using a title clip containing the drop shadow, with this clip simply below your picture-in-picture clip.

Doing drop shdows as an effect would have to be done at the MLT or frei0r level, so with different upstream projects. Such an effect would need several parameters, such zoom and position, as well as the shadow parameters. Thr zoom, position, and rotation would need to be keyframable (animatable). A lot of work for a dedicated effect...
